If you want to go to bed, bring in the supper and set it on the table.

It will be nearly as good cold.

Leave the door unbarred.' Mrs.Wake did as was suggested, made up the fire, and went away.

Shortly afterwards Christine heard her retire to her chamber.

But Christine still sat on, and still her husband postponed his entry.
She aroused herself once or twice to freshen the fire, but was ignorant how the night was going.
